The  VIII International Ethnic Festival "Krutushka" will be held August 27 at the camp "Baitik" ( Krutushka, Kazan, Republic of Tatarstan).

 

For spectators and participants of  “Krutushka”- is an unforgettable encounter with the colorful world of the traditional culture of different peoples: familiarity with the contemporary trends of ethno-music, master classes in arts and crafts, fair of original crafts, a variety of art projects, exhibitions, performances, theater and dance performances, presentations, movies, and more.

 

Among the participants of the musical program: Commonwealth of progressive musicians and ethnic vocalists  "Ethnosphere" (Moscow), the world-renowned virtuoso guitarist Enver Izmailov (Ukraine), a leading folklorist and collector of traditional songs and instruments, Sergei Starostin (Moscow), a female vocal percussion team «Tambores» (Moscow), famous for incendiary Latin American rhythms, as well as many representatives of the traditional culture of the peoples of Russia.

 

At the  eighth   "Krutushka"  spectators  will  get acquainted with  native musical traditions of the Tatars, Kryashens, Russians, Mari,  Chuvashs, Udmurts. Master puppeteer Viktor Kuular from the Republic of Tuva and his family theater "Tokuu" will present Tuva original puppet shows. Some of the best performers of throat singing of the Republic of Bashkortostan - members of the ensemble "Sal Ural" - willing to teach the basics of the skill. Also,   music lovers are waiting for master classes in playing  vargan   the jew's harp, exotic Australian didgeridoo and ultramodern tool - hangu.

 

The festival will unfold traditional fair of unique handmade goods, a variety of artisans will  organize master classes. The  guests of  “Krutushka”  discover  how  handicrafts appear, and do try to create unique things with blacksmiths and potters,  work  as a carver, weaver, baker, jeweler.

 

The Festival "Krutushka" is  traditional familial,  unites representatives of older and younger generations, to create an environment of dialogue, based on the transmission of unique knowledge, folk wisdom. For children of all ages and their parents  a special  Ethnopedagogical program  is being prepared .

 

All  the  "Krutushka" events will be held in the "Baitik" children's health camp. For spectators provided accommodation in a tent camp near the Kazanka river or at the campsite in a comfortable housing. It offers a well-developed infrastructure and proximity to the pristine nature - woods, non-frozen Blue lakes.

 

Kazan residents have the opportunity to get on Krutushka by bus №78 or additional bus that will be organized on the day of the festival. For personal transport guests, there is a guarded parking lot.

 

The event is held within the framework of the state program "The implementation of the national policy in the Republic of Tatarstan for 2014 - 2020 years."

 

The organizers of the festival are the "Center of Information Technologies in Education", a creative association "Anto" supported by the Ministry of Culture of the Republic of Tatarstan, the Ministry of Youth, Sports and Tourism of the Republic of Tatarstan, Administration  of the  Vysokogorsky municipal district of the Republic of Tatarstan.
